Bill Summary
A bill for an act relating to economic development; requiring a report; appropriating money.
AI Summary
This bill appropriates $5 million from the state's general fund in fiscal year 2026 to the Commissioner of Employment and Economic Development to provide grants for developing enterprises, supply chains, and markets related to continuous living cover crops. Continuous living cover crops are agricultural practices that maintain plant coverage on farmland year-round, which can help improve soil health and sustainability. The grants will specifically support early-stage commercial development of innovative agricultural systems such as regenerative poultry silvopasture (integrating livestock, trees, and crops), Kernza (a perennial grain), winter camelina (an oilseed crop), and elderberry production. Grantees are prohibited from receiving funding for the same purposes from another state agency in the same calendar year. The bill requires the commissioner to submit a report by January 15th, 2027, to legislative committee chairs detailing how the grant funds were used, including administrative costs. The appropriation is designated as a one-time funding allocation.
